Talbros Automotive Components: An Overview
Talbros Automotive Components, a prominent player in the Indian auto components industry, is renowned for supplying a wide range of products such as gaskets, heat shields, forging components, chassis systems, and hoses. Over the years, the company has established itself as a trusted partner for leading original equipment manufacturers (OEMs), both in India and abroad.
The company operates through several joint ventures, which have played a pivotal role in expanding its technological capabilities and market reach. The ₹580 Crore Order Win: Breaking Down the Details
The latest milestone for Talbros comes in the form of multi-year contracts worth ₹580 crore, secured by the company and its joint ventures. Orders include a diverse mix of offerings like gaskets, insulation shields, forging elements, structural parts, and tubing. Notably, a significant portion of these contracts is dedicated to the electric vehicle segment, reflecting the company’s strategic alignment with the global shift towards sustainable mobility.
Of the total order value, approximately ₹260 crore is attributed directly to Talbros’s core business, with a substantial share earmarked for exports, primarily to European markets. The company’s joint venture, Marelli Talbros Chassis Systems, is responsible for a further ₹290 crore in orders, with about half of this amount tied to EV-related components. Orders for hoses and anti-vibration parts are expected to enter commercial production in the second half of the next fiscal year.
This diversified order book not only enhances revenue visibility for the coming years but also underscores Talbros’s ability to cater to evolving customer needs across geographies and vehicle segments.
Stock Market Reaction: A Five-Month High
The announcement of the ₹580 crore order win triggered a sharp rally in Talbros Automotive Components’ share price, which surged over 8% in intraday trading. This upward momentum pushed the stock to its highest level in five months, reflecting renewed investor confidence in the company’s growth prospects.
According to analysts, multiple factors have contributed to this upswing.:
• The scale and diversity of the new orders, which span both traditional and emerging automotive technologies.
• The growing contribution of the EV segment, which is expected to drive future growth.
• The company’s expanding footprint in export markets, particularly Europe, known for its rigorous quality and sustainability standards.

Strategic Focus: Electric Vehicles and Exports
A defining feature of the recent order win is the company’s increasing focus on electric vehicles and international markets. Approximately 50% of the chassis system orders from the joint venture are destined for the EV segment, underscoring Talbros’s proactive approach to capitalizing on the global transition to electric mobility.
The company’s export strategy is equally noteworthy. With around ₹150 crore of the new orders allocated for exports—mainly to Europe—Talbros is leveraging its technological expertise and quality standards to tap into markets with high entry barriers. This not only diversifies its revenue streams but also positions the company as a key supplier to some of the world’s most demanding automotive markets.
